Special needs parents are beyond excited about Target's new adaptive clothing line, launching November 22. The new clothes will be available on Target.com, joining the sensory friendly items already available in Target's line of adaptive clothing.
While clothing lines for kids (and adults) with special needs aren?t necessarily a novelty, nearly all of these lines are complicated by at least one of three big issues.
1. These clothes can be incredibly hard to find. Availability is definitely an issue. In my experience, you have to buy online, or not at all.
2. They're also expensive. Most vendors hand-make the clothing for each individual child after purchase. So the price per piece is usually out of this world -- especially for a child who will outwear and outgrow clothing in a flash. 3. The clothing available to parents like me just doesn't look normal. Most of the apparel options are very obviously adaptive clothing. So we must choose between functionality and looking more out of place.
Trust me, #3 is a big thing for parents who have children with special needs. We want our kids to be comfortable and wear clothes that work for them. But we also want them to feel like they fit in.
